How many factors of 28 × 32 × 53 × 75 are even numbers?1. 5762. 2883. 1684. 464 |
|
Answer» Correct Answer - Option 1 : 576 Concept used: A given natural number can be expressed as 2a.3b.5c.7d...... and so on Where a, b, c, d ...... and so on are whole numbers Total number of factors = (a + 1) × (b + 1) × (c + 1) × (d + 1) ...... and so on Total number of even factors = a × (b + 1) × (c + 1) × (d + 1) ...... and so on Calculation: Total number of even factors = 8 × (2 + 1) × (3 + 1) × (5 + 1) ∴ Total numbers of even factors is 576 |
